Zombicide Invader crossover pack they got this out quick P:E seems to get he better end of the crossover.

For $15 this Kickstarter Exclusive Optional Buy not only brings all the Survivors, Workers, Hunters, Tanks, Machines, and the Abomination from Zombicide: Invader to Project: ELITE but also ports all Heroes, the Biter Swarm and 2 Bosses from Project: ELITE into Zombicide: Invader! It contains 60 cards plus 6 cardboard Hero Dashboards! Please note this Crossover Set will not be available on retail.

The Crossover set comes with 6 Survivor ID Cards to bring Project: ELITE Heroes as Survivors for Zombicide: Invader, where they all function as Soldiers:

The Crossover set comes with 18 Xeno Cards to port Biters as a new type of Worker, as well as Thraex and Gutslug as brand-new Abominations:

The Crossover set comes with 6 cardboard Hero dashboards to bring the Survivors from Zombicide: Invader as Heroes for Project: ELITE

Finally, the Crossover set comes with 34 cards to bring Workers, Hunters, and Tanks as Swarms as well as the Abomination as an all-new Boss:



and from the Zc:I update as someone's likely to ask.

You will need a base pledge of Project: ELITE to be able to purchase it.

New expansion



The Alienship Rescue Expansion comes with:

4 Boss figures
15 Swarm figures
4 Boss cards
1 Swarm Stat card
10 Swarm Spawn cards
7 double-sided Game Tiles
15 tokens
1 Rulebook
Backers who get the Alienship Rescue expansion during this Kickstarter campaign will also get the Kickstarter Exclusive Heroine Sarah Morgan, including her figure and dashboard!


















So Cyclops is a close combat Jaggernat posted above
Faun and Worm is a redesigned Phaedrus Psiren



And Sarah was originally a Castellan Medic (Heavier armoured Samaritan)
